The mathematician and scientist Ordinary Prof. Dr. Stating that the “ARF Supercomputer” named after Cahit Arf has a computing capacity of 35,000 laptops, Saygın said that ARF is the 313th best-equipped supercomputer in the world.
Pointing out that the direct liquid-cooled supercomputer ARF cluster, whose investment was made in 2023, consists of about 55,000 cores, the volunteer said: “The resource capacity of the TRUBA system reaches more than 80,000 computing cores. With ARF, we have a wide range of applications from the defense industry to the manufacturing sector, from drug design to disease detection.” “Simulations that researchers in many areas need can be carried out simultaneously,” he said.
Large artificial intelligence models can also be developed
Saygın emphasized that the ARF supercomputer, which will increase Türkiye's global competitiveness, is the most important part of artificial intelligence technologies:
“We commissioned the ARF supercomputer within TÜBİTAK. At the same time, we became a partner of 'MareNostrum', which was founded as part of the EU supercomputer community initiative EURO HPC. We also commissioned this one this year. We have completed our preparations for the call to the private sector to use the ARF supercomputer. Volunteer added that thanks to ARF, long-term modeling of large systems such as the creation of digital twins, climate change studies, high-precision aerodynamic design and verification studies, and the development of large artificial intelligence models will be possible.
